Recycled wool throws are made primarily from recycled wool (examples in the listings show 80% and 55%), some are 100% wool, and others use blends that include recycled polyester and wool (example: 48% recycled polyester with 30% wool). Some blends also include other recycled man-made fibers.
Care varies by product: many list machine wash (often cold, gentle) with the option to tumble dry on low, while others recommend line dry or lay flat to dry. At least one throw is labeled dry clean only—always check the item's care label before cleaning.
